A Paw And A Prayer Dog Rescue

APAAP is a non-profit, small-dog and puppy rescue in Chattanooga, operated by volunteers and funded by monies collected from adoption fees and donations.

We rescue dogs from kill shelters and make them publicly known/available for adoption to good homes and great families.

All A Paw and A Prayer dogs are seen by a licensed veterinarian. All adults are spay/neutered, heartworm tested, dewormed, given rabies and DAPP booster. All puppies are given deworming medication, age-appropriate shots, and spay/neutered if they meet the age/weight criteria determined by the vet.

A Paw and A Prayer Rescue started from friends with a common bond - to help dogs that were abandoned, neglected and abused in the Chattanooga and surrounding areas. We are volunteers who work other jobs and in our “spare” time we bring dogs into our home setting and begin the adoption process. We are not funded by any organization and operate from our own resources and donations. We rely entirely on the generosity of friends and strangers. Some dogs come to us by owners who no longer want them or who can no longer care for them. Often owners surrender their pets to local shelters and there is a chance that their beloved pet could be euthanized. This is where APAAP comes into the picture - we try to help reduce the number of pets turned into shelters. We also try to help our local shelters by pulling abandoned adoptable pets into our foster program. As APAAP has grown we have initiated a Foster Parent Program. Without our foster parents we could not pull and rescue as many dogs as we do.
